Schwartzman, Jessica M.; Hardan, Antonio Y.; Gengoux, Grace W. – Autism: The International Journal of Research and Practice, 2021
Elevated parenting stress among parents of children with autism spectrum disorder is well-documented; however, there is limited information about variability in parenting stress and relationships with parent ratings of child functioning. The aim of this study was to explore profiles of parenting stress among 100 parents of young children with…

Smith, Jodie; Sulek, Rhylee; Abdullahi, Ifrah; Green, Cherie C.; Bent, Catherine A.; Dissanayake, Cheryl; Hudry, Kristelle – Autism: The International Journal of Research and Practice, 2021
Parents from individualist cultures (those focused on autonomy of individuals; that is, Australian) may view their autistic children differently compared to parents from collectivist cultures (where community needs are valued over an individual's, that is, South-East Asian cultures). As most research on autism and parenting has been undertaken in…
